
It was a night and day full of laughs at the fourth annual, 24-hour improvathon at Chum’s last weekend.
The event kicked off at 8PM Friday night. Each of Brandeis’ four improvisational comedy groups took turns performing through the night and subsequent day until 8PM Saturday evening.
Although some were forced into a comedy coma, the laughs kept coming from most of the crowd for 24 straight hours. The successful improvathon raised close to 500 dollars, which the groups plan to donate to Oxfam International.

Here is a sampling of Improv and sketch comedy groups on campus:
Bad Grammer is the Brandeis' premier zany improv group (pictured at top), and the only one with a mascot (the mystical catapus)! They play shortform games and perform longform scenes. All practices are open... which means ANYONE can come and improv with them!
Boris' Kitchen is the only UTC group dedicated to all new, all original sketch comedy. We write, direct, and perform sketches to the delight of audiences everywhere, even those not at our show.
TBA is Brandeis' only Improv and Improv Inspired Sketch Comedy Troupe.
